How Gabawell 100 Tablet works:
Epileptic seizures and nerve pain may be alleviated by Gabawell 100 Tablets, an anticonvulsant. Its mechanism in epilepsy involves suppressing excessive brain electrical discharges, thereby preventing seizure onset. In neuropathic pain, it acts by disrupting the transmission of pain signals along damaged nerves and to the brain, providing pain relief.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Concomitant use of Gabawell 100 Tablet and alcohol may induce pronounced somnolence.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Use of Gabawell 100 Tablet during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Nursing mothers can likely use Gabawell 100 Tablet without significant risk. Available data indicates minimal danger to the infant. However, infant monitoring for drowsiness and weight changes is advised.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Gabawell 100 T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with impaired kidney function should exercise caution when using Gabawell 100 T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Insufficient data exists regarding Gabawell 100 Tablet's use in individuals with hepatic impairment.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Gabawell 100 Tablet :
Should you forget a Gabawell 100 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Never take a double dose.
